Overview

The Ma Tiger US AI Semiconductor Fund ETF represents a pivotal financial instrument tailored to echo the dynamism within the US semiconductor landscape, with an accentuated emphasis on entities at the forefront of artificial intelligence (AI) and its ancillary technologies. This exchange-traded fund (ETF) affords both retail and institutional investors a streamlined conduit to a curated compilation of US-centric semiconductor organizations. These firms are at the vanguard of pioneering AI-centric innovations, serving as the bedrock for sectors including, but not limited to, autonomous driving, data processing centers, and next-gen computing paradigms. The ETF is strategically positioned to benefit from the escalating adoption and integration of AI-driven technologies across diversified industrial sectors, thereby offering a comprehensive window into the semiconductor industry's critical role in fueling the AI era.
